During this ceremony we generate the partner signing key, confirm its fingerprint aloud, and escrow the shards. Your plugin manifest must reference the ceremony release tag; unsigned builds are rejected at ingest. Keep your local keystore offline between releases. Should the escrowed keystore require emergency unsealing, the shard custodians combine it with the recovery passphrase written just below.

strongbox words: zorwyn-sorael-belion-ulaius-silmir-ulays-briax-rusdor-gorix

The current term expires in fourteen months; holding over would trigger a 25% rate escalation. Our counterproposal seeks a seven-year extension at a 6% reduction, in exchange for surrendering the unused east annex. Pellgrave has responded favorably but wants commitments on occupancy levels. Facilities has modeled three scenarios; all show savings against renewal at market rates. The occupancy commitment question hinges on the confidential plan noted below.

management briefing: Ralokix Partners plans to lower the Istath list price by 38 percent in October.

Internal Memo — Training Budget, Next Fiscal Year

For the incoming director: the proposed training budget for Lanthorne Fabrication rises 12% to fund the apprenticeship intake at the Durnwick plant and certification renewals for the finishing teams. Uptake last year exceeded forecast, and Helda Prosse recommends ring-fencing funds for supervisory development. Allocation detail follows in the spreadsheet; strategic context is given in the note below.

board note of kageg-bahof: The renewal with Holwynax Holdings closes at $2 million a year, 5 percent below the last contract. Project Ulaath slips by two quarters because of the supplier delay.

Briefing: Leadership Review — Budget Request

Finance team: Corven Analytics requests an additional 1.4M for the Larkspur platform build. Headcount: four engineers, one analyst. Offset proposed via deferral of the Melwick refresh. Payback modelled at 19 months. Risks: vendor pricing and delayed onboarding. Decision needed before the quarter close. The confidential note below sets out the underlying business plans.

board note of tajef-yagep: Tamaxix Partners plans to raise the Gorael list price by 38 percent in January.